I wavered between 4/5 stars, because of what this actually is. The property/cabin is pretty utilitarian and spartan, so 5 stars doesn't seem right. On the other hand, if that's what you're looking for, Healing Springs does it very well, the price is right, the cabin was clean, and the process was easy. So count this as 4.5 stars.

Check in: we didn't check in until after dinner, as it was getting dark. No problem finding the property or cabin, and self-checkin was easy and went off without a hitch. There's even a little general store where you not only get your key, but they also have snacks/drinks/etc that you can charge to your cabin or pay on the honor system.

Cabin: 3 adults total, we stayed in the Barn Loft. It's definitely dated (and the floor in the sitting room definitely goes uphill then back down as you cross the room), but that's about what we expected. More importantly, everything was clean and the AC in all the rooms blew COLD! Kitchenette and bathroom are downstairs. The kitchenette was nice to have, even though we didn't use it. The shower could use a redesign, as it's pretty hard not to get a bunch of water on the floor. But that's a small complaint.

Property: Great lil property tucked back but still accessible to West Jefferson. It's really cool that they let you get water from the spring! I will say there was a little canvas tent erected to the right of the barn loft that looked CREEPY at night (checking it out the next morning made it look like maybe they keep firewood in there?)

Check-out/billing: Check out was easy. We left the place clean, but it's still nice to see that no mysterious, undisclosed fees or penalties got added to our bill.

Overall: If you're fine with a fairly bare accommodation, it's hard to beat this value in the area!...

We stayed at the Finch cabin for two nights and were disappointed that we did not have the same experience that so many reviewers had. The self check in was a total failure. The key was not left at the counter and when we called the number listed in the instructions whoever picked up hung up. We then chased down the lady that was cleaning the cabins and finally got her attention (it appeared she was ignoring us) when she came over she was complaining that they threw another check in on her as she went over to get the key for us and made us feel like we were an inconvenience rather than guests. Although we didn’t get a good welcome we were however greeted by a roach when we stepped into the cabin. The cabin was adequate, but just because they were built in the early 1900 does not mean they cannot be charming. There were places to have a fire but no instructions on how to get any supplies or heads up to bring any. Parking was also difficult because the spots in front of each unit were marked by a log that was not aligned correctly either leaving your car hanging in the street or too close to the other car. The small creek was pretty but it does no justice to many other beautiful streams and creeks in the area. Luckily we were there for the awesome hiking at Grayson park and we really enjoyed the beauty of the area away from the cabins at healing springs. I recommend that you do more research in other area accommodations before booking the cabins as we wished we did.
